Translate and Solve Applications

In the following exercises, translate into an algebraic equation and solve.

Rochelle’s daughter is 11 years old. Her son is 3 years younger. How old is her son?

Got questions? Get instant answers now!

Tan weighs 146 pounds. Minh weighs 15 pounds more than Tan. How much does Minh weigh?

161 pounds

Got questions? Get instant answers now!

Peter paid $9.75 to go to the movies, which was $46.25 less than he paid to go to a concert. How much did he pay for the concert?

Got questions? Get instant answers now!

Elissa earned $152.84 this week, which was $21.65 more than she earned last week. How much did she earn last week?

$131.19
